Output dd8128e96153a96ba9f30c5c1dbd8121f49d54a184d8c008b91cd1d8bc59d9e6:1

value
11664
script pubkey
OP_0 OP_PUSHBYTES_20 71db08826c23f6af02c35ce2c17ed45fea3c8865
address
bc1qw8ds3qnvy0m27qkrtn3vzlk5tl4rezr9kxd36m
transaction
dd8128e96153a96ba9f30c5c1dbd8121f49d54a184d8c008b91cd1d8bc59d9e6
spent
true